> This condition reads a bit weirdly. Why do we care about anything else
> than !nested_virt_in_use() ?
> 
> If nested virt is not in use then obviously we return the error.
> 
> If nested virt is in use then why do we care about EL1? Or should this
> test read as "highest_el_is_32bit" ?

There are multiple things at play here:

- MODE_EL2x is not a valid 32bit mode
- The architecture forbids nested virt with 32bit EL2

The code above is a simplification of these two conditions. But
certainly we can do a bit better, as kvm_reset_cpu() doesn't really
check that we don't create a vcpu with both 32bit+NV. These two bits
should really be exclusive.
